Durgapur in context

With 2,611 people at the 2011 Census, Durgapur was the 185th most populous of its district's 868 villages, above the district average of 1,699.

Literacy stood at 75.95%, 15.4 points above the district's rural average of 60.51%.

The sex ratio was 856 women per 1,000 men (52 below the district's rural figure of 908). Among children aged 0–6 the ratio was 857, 66 below the rural national 923.

29.3% of the population were recorded as workers, 11.2 points below the district's rural rate.
